Liverpool ran chaos at Anfield in the second leg of the semi-final round of the EFL Cup against Tottenham Hotspur. Trailing 1-0 prior to the first whistle, the Premier League leaders showed why they are the most in-form team in the world at present.

The Reds showed no mercy and netted four goals to secure a berth for the finale. Their next game is against Plymouth Argyle in the 4th round of the FA Cup. Arne Slot will be aiming for another victory to go deep into the competition.

4-2-3-1 Liverpool Predicted Lineup vs Plymouth Argyle

Defence

Caoimhin Kelleher didn’t have much to do against Spurs and kept an easy clean sheet. He should be operating between the sticks once again. No change at the right-back spot as Conor Bradley continues to play there.

Jarell Quansah and Wataru Endō are likely to be deployed in the centre of the defence in place of Ibrahima Konate and Virgil van Dijk. A rest for left-back Andy Robertson as well as Konstantinos Tsimikas takes his duties.

Midfield

James McConnell is expected to get a chance to play in the middle of the park alongside Alexis Mac Allister. The Argentine will play after getting a well-deserved rest.

Attack

Arne Slot would surely not bother Mohamed Salah to play in this fixture and Harvey Elliott is likely to play on the right flank. Federico Chiesa and Luiz Diaz are also called up to take the offensive roles.

Darwin Nunez continues to play as the striker in the lineup.

Slot has already confirmed that Trent Alexander-Arnold isn’t going to be part of this game. Hence, the Reds have him as an absentee apart from Tyler Morton.
